[0032] The specific implementation of the water pump is a cantilever single-stage single-suction double-blade centrifugal pump with a specific speed n s =111, the rated working condition is: flow Q=25.86m 3 / h, head H=2.68m, speed n=750r / min. The implementation motor is a three-phase asynchronous motor with a rated power of 7.5kW.

[0033] Build the test bench of the water pump unit: the three-phase asynchronous motor 7 of the water pump unit is equipped with a motor temperature sensor Pt1008, a motor vibration sensor HZ-892A9 and a coil induction speed sensor 11, and the three-phase asynchronous motor 7 is connected to the three-phase power line. Transformer BH-0.66-30I14; the pump body vibration sensor 25 in the XYZ three directions is installed on the test pump 1, which is INV983; the outlet hydrophone RHSA-103, the inlet hydrophone 20, and the outlet hydrophone The pressure sensor 4 is MIK-P300, the inlet pressure sensor MIK-P30019 and the outlet pressure pulsation senso...

Abstract

The invention discloses a pump unit typical health status monitoring device and method based on Internet of Things, and belongs to the technical field of intelligent diagnosis of fluid machinery Internet of Things. The pump unit typical health status monitoring device is arranged to be an erecting pump unit platform. Signal collecting sensors are arranged on the pump unit to form an Internet of Things sensing layer which is used as a collection module of data transmission, and forms an Internet of Things network layer with communication protocol; and a field monitoring platform forms an Internet of Things application layer by a touch screen / PC and compiled upper computer software. Functions performance testing, signal processing, fault diagnosing, health evaluating, database managing and remote monitoring and real time monitoring of the pump unit are achieved. Integration, automation and intellectualization of the system are high; predicative maintenance is achieved; occurrence of major accidents and economic loss are avoided, alleviated and reduced; optimal management of pump unit operation is facilitated; benefit level is improved; and pump unit overhauling and maintenance basisis provided.

technical field [0001] The invention belongs to the technical field of fluid machinery Internet of Things intelligent diagnosis, and in particular relates to a typical health state monitoring method of a water pump unit based on the Internet of Things. Background technique [0002] A pump is a machine that converts the mechanical energy of the prime mover into liquid energy. It is widely used in various fields of the national economy, from industry to agriculture, civilian to military, general technical departments to cutting-edge technical departments, etc. Pumps are inseparable. The water pump unit is also the key equipment in many industrial production systems. Once a failure occurs, it will affect production at least, and cause equipment shutdown and process interruption at worst, resulting in serious economic losses and even threatening life safety.
